Two carts move in the same direction along a frictionless airtrack, each acted on by the same constant force for a timeinterval Dt. Cart 2 has twice the mass of cart 1. Which one ofthe following statements is true? (a) Each cart has the samechange in momentum. (b) Cart 1 has the greater change inmomentum. (c) Cart 2 has the greater change in momentum.(d) The changes in momenta depend on the initial velocities.
